Break-In at the Savory Plate
The Savory Plate was allegedly broken into over Wednesday night.

Police were called to the Arlington Heights eatery at about 11 a.m. Thursday for a report of a past break-in. There, one of the Savory Plate’s owners told police that someone had entered his business through the back door and taken roughly $200 from a box in his office.
The owner said a bottle of cough medicine was also moved and it appeared that the perpetrator consumed the bottle during the break-in.
